An on-demand logistics platform is software that lets customers book a courier, parcel, or last-mile delivery on demand and tracks it from pickup to drop-off. It connects senders, delivery partners, and an operations team through a routing engine, live GPS tracking, proof of delivery, and automated billing based on distance, weight, and zone.
Embedded insurance platform development is the process of building software that enables non-insurance brands to offer coverage at checkout or in their apps via APIs. It has three layers: a contextual offer engine that decides what to show and when, a partner-facing integration layer of quote and bind APIs, and a carrier layer that handles underwriting, policy, and claims.
A school management system is software that runs a school's core operations, admissions, attendance, grades, fees, timetabling, and parent communication, from one connected platform. It replaces scattered registers and spreadsheets with a single source of truth, automates reporting, and gives administrators, teachers, and parents secure role-based access to the records they need.
A tours and activities booking platform lets travellers search, schedule, and pay for experiences while operators manage inventory in real time. It is built on four pillars: a scheduling engine for time slots and departures, a real-time availability module to prevent overbooking, a supplier management portal for operators to control their own inventory, and a booking and payment flow. The hard part is capacity, not the booking button.
